titleOfInvention | Aqueous polish |
abstract | (57) [Summary] [Purpose] To provide a highly glossy water-based polish which has moderate walking properties and is highly resistant to black heel marks on shoes. [Structure] Consists of 5 to 60% by weight of a wax component made of a long-chain aliphatic (meth) acrylate polymer such as stearyl (meth) acrylate and 40 to 95% by weight of a binder component made of an acrylic polymer or polyurethane resin. The composition is dispersed in an aqueous medium. |
